Foundation Crack Repair in Lakeville, MA
Foundation crack repair services address issues where existing cracks in a building’s foundation may compromise structural integrity or allow water intrusion. These projects typically involve assessing the severity and location of cracks, then applying appropriate solutions such as ep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or sealing to prevent further damage. Homeowners often request this service after noticing signs like u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in basement walls, aiming to protect their property value and ensure safety.
Before requesting foundation crack repair, property owners usually want to understand the types of cracks present-whether they are hairline, vertical, or horizontal-as well as the underlying causes, such as settling or soil movement. It’s also common to seek information on the best repair methods for their specific situation and the potential need for ongoing monitoring or additional foundation stabilization. Clear communication about the condition of the foundation helps ensure that the most effective and appropriate repair solutions are implemented.

Foundation Crack Repair Questions
What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around the property.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ious problems? Not all cracks indicate structural issues; some are minor and do not affect stability.
How can foundation cracks be repaired? Repair methods include epoxy injections, crack sealing, and foundation underpinning, depending on the severity.
When should property owners consider repair services? Cracks that are wide, growing, or accompanied by other signs like uneven floors should be evaluated for repair options.
